One morning, in the misty moments before first light, Brian Faulkner awoke inspired. So he grabbed a pencil and sketched out some quick lines before they got lost in the dawn. His words eventually became Carolina Prayer, a small book of words and pictures that expressed thankfulness about our state's many blessings. It was the first book published under Our State magazine's new imprint, and readers loved it! A Second Edition of Carolina Prayer now is in process that also includes Brian's photography. |
